The French Open takes place between May 25 - June 8, 2025 with our Tournament Centre helping you through every moment including schedule, TV Guide, Prize Money among others.
Iga Swiatek is current defending champion winning the title last year but is currently going through some semblance of turmoil with the former World No.1 slipping quickly down the rankings. Aryna Sabalenka as a result could be considered favourite for the title.
Sabalenka is the imperious World No.1 with Coco Gauff after recent good form World No.2. Also don't count out Jessica Pegula and Jasmine Paolini among others. Two weeks of action in Paris incoming and we have you covered.

Prize Money

€2,550,000 being supplied to the winner in Euros in 2025. €1,275,000 will go to the runner-up and goes all the way down to €168,000 for losing in the opening round.
It is equal between ATP and WTA with Iga Swiatek taking home the same amount as Carlos Alcaraz who also won the title last year. That will continue this year.
